  1. The Clean Industrial Deal is the European Commission’s flagship policy – but despite the name, it’s not so clean and definitely not green. The result of very heavy industry lobbying, it focuses on weakening regulations and throwing money at some of the EU’s most polluting companies. All while the public foot the bill. Let Corporate Europe Observatory guide you through the basics with our answers to some frequently asked questions.

  3. EU-Lobbyausgaben der #Digitalbranche: 151 Millionen Euro jährlich.

    👉 Die Top 10 Digitalkonzerne geben 48 Mio. € für Lobbyarbeit aus – das ist fast ein Drittel der gesamten Lobbyausgaben der Digitalbranche. Sie geben damit mehr Geld für #Lobbyarbeit aus, als die Top 10 der Pharma-, Finanz- oder Automobilindustrie zusammen.

  17. CW: Online event 12th June about "Soil health and EU competitiveness"

    I received this invitation. (comments at the end)

    ------------------------------------
    Dear Colleagues,

    The first part of the 5th EUSO Stakeholders Forum will be an online event on 12th June, focussing on the topic "Soil health and EU competitiveness". During this event, case studies from the private sector will show how healthy soils can promote competitiveness in terms of the three pillars:
    a) closing the innovation gap
    b) decarbonisation and competitiveness
    c) reducing excessive dependencies

    The event includes presentations from the biotechnology sector, agribusiness, banking-financial sector, remediation industry, start-ups, carbon farming, development of clean products and retail industry.

    More information as Agenda, Speakers and Registration can be found in the page:

    esdac.jrc.ec.europa.eu/euso/5t

    Kind Regards,
    Panos PANAGOS, PhD.

    Scientific/Research Officer
    Project Leader of EU Soil Observatory (EUSO)

    -----------------------------------

    My thoughts:
    Ok, we need urgently more awareness about soils. We need more #OrganicAgriculture, #RegenerativeAgriculture, #AgroecologicalTransition, #CommunitySupportedAgriculture and much more. What we *definitely* don't need, is a meeting with NOT A SINGLE FARMER, but people from Syngenta, Bayer, Nestlé and a bunch of other industry representatives to allow them to show that they are trying soo hard to protect our environment while they do everything they can to sabotage meaningful policy changes. Venture capital funded Start-ups and old villains are definitely not the structural change the agrifood-system needs.

    Maybe it will still be an informative event, who knows.

    Thank you for listening.
